Deep in South Africa
Before it was general-purpose, CoreOps had to survive SARS, POPIA, load shedding, and Xero's dominance in South African bookkeeping. Those foundations didn't get diluted when the platform generalised — they're still exactly this deep.
Sequential receipt numbering per location, per year — enforced at the database level, never editable.
Standard, zero-rated, and exempt VAT treatment, built into every transaction type from the ground up.
Timesheet exports formatted for direct bulk import — no manual re-keying of hours.
The Sales Terminal keeps working offline and syncs automatically the moment connectivity returns.
Data subject requests, consent tracking, and retention policies designed against South African privacy law.

Why CoreOps
These aren't marketing claims — they're architectural decisions, made deliberately and enforced at the database level.
Cost recognised at point of sale
Never at invoice date — margin accuracy is built into the ledger itself, not calculated after the fact.
Every transaction is immutable
Corrections happen through reversal entries — nothing is ever edited or deleted from the financial record.
One login, one ledger
Back office and floor operations read and write to the exact same source of truth — no reconciliation between systems.
Multi-tenant from day one
Every table isolated by company at the database engine level, enforced by row-level security — not just application code.
Built by a practising accountant
Every accounting decision in the platform is explainable in accounting terms, not just engineering terms.
Designed to scale
From a single site to a multi-company, multi-currency group — the architecture doesn’t change, only the configuration.
